Can anyone shed any light
I decided to reroute the pipes for the radiator in the hallway, the were on the wall, and then ran under the radiator and then into each end.
I decided to run them under the floor and just have them sticking out of the floor, straight into the radiator connections.
Trouble is now, after replacing the radiator, and getting all the air out of it, the radiator will not get warm, the other radiators in the house do, not this one though.
The radiator is fitted with one standard valve and a thermostat valve, could I have done something to these?
